Skip to content

A farmer friendly bot to solve their problems with machine learning and robotics

Notifications You must be signed in to change notification settings

ralouekapoor06/technofarm

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

10 Commits
 
 
 
 
 
 
 
 

Repository files navigation

Techno_Farm

A farmer friendly bot to solve the problems of the farmers with machine learning

What is Technofarm ?

We have found that many farmers in india face the problem of getting accurate insights about their crop. Farmers try to make their best guess for predicting but they are not right for most of the times. For solving this issue we have come up with an autonomous bot which could move on the field and make predictions for the crop below.

Tech Stack used and references ?

Software:-All the libraries mentioned below and Kaggle

Hardware:-Arduino

Libraries to be installed before running

  1. numpy
  2. tensorflow
  3. matplotlib
  4. keras
  5. pickle
  6. sklearn
  7. opencv

Directory structure before running the following code

--TechnoFarm
|--Arduino and connections
|--ip_webcam.py
|--Plant_disease
|--PlantVillage
|--PlantVillage
|--Pepperbell ...
|--Potato ...
.
.
.
.
|--train.py
|--test.py
|--weed_in_soyabean
|--dataset
|--broadleaf
|--grass
|--soil
|--soyabean
|--train.py
|--test.py
|--labels_transform.pkl

Dataset link

https://www.kaggle.com/emmarex/plantdisease
https://www.kaggle.com/fpeccia/weed-detection-in-soybean-crops

About

A farmer friendly bot to solve their problems with machine learning and robotics

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ages